B14. The last two amino acids added to a polypeptide are - Trp - Glu - (C terminus). The last two anticodons that were used in its translation are, in order of their use: Second-to-last anticodon Last anticodon A) 5-CCA-3' 5-UUC-3 B) 5-UUC-3 5-CCA-3 C) 5-ACC-3' 5'-CUU-3 D) 5-GGU-3' 5'-AAG-3 E) 5'-AAG-3' 5-GGU-3
